As you get older, your body's ability to metabolize food slows down. Environmental factors include lifestyle behaviors such as what a person eats and how active he or she is. Psychological factors, such as depression and low self-esteem may, in some cases, also play a role in weight gain. The medication some people are taking may also have a responsibility to someone becoming overweight.
Obesity cause physical problems, psychological, social and economic well-being problems. The more a person is overweight the greater risk of death.
